/**
|
||
|
|
* Top-level tls configuration options. These options are used to create a context from which
|
||
|
|
* per-connection TLS contexts can be created.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
class AWS_CRT_CPP_API TlsContextOptions
|
||
|
|
{
|
||
|
|
friend class TlsContext;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
public:
|
||
|
|
TlsContextOptions() noexcept;
|
||
|
|
virtual ~TlsContextOptions();
|
||
|
|
TlsContextOptions(const TlsContextOptions &) noexcept = delete;
|
||
|
|
TlsContextOptions &operator=(const TlsContextOptions &) noexcept = delete;
|
||
|
|
TlsContextOptions(TlsContextOptions &&)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
TlsContextOptions &operator=(TlsContextOptions &&)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* @return true if the instance is in a valid state, false otherwise.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
explicit operator bool() const noexcept { return m_isInit; }
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* @return the value of the last aws error encountered by operations on this instance.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
int LastError() const no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* Initializes TlsContextOptions with secure by default options, with
|
||
|
|
* no client certificates.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
static TlsContextOptions InitDefaultClient(Allocator *allocator = ApiAllocator())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* Initializes TlsContextOptions for mutual TLS (mTLS), with
|
||
|
|
* client certificate and private key. These are paths to a file on disk. These files
|
||
|
|
* must be in the PEM format.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* NOTE: This is unsupported on iOS.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* @param cert_path: Path to certificate file.
|
||
|
|
* @param pkey_path: Path to private key file.
|
||
|
|
* @param allocator Memory allocator to use.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
static TlsContextOptions InitClientWithMtls(
|
||
|
|
const char *cert_path,
|
||
|
|
const char *pkey_path,
|
||
|
|
Allocator *allocator = ApiAllocator())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* Initializes TlsContextOptions for mutual TLS (mTLS), with
|
||
|
|
* client certificate and private key. These are in memory buffers. These buffers
|
||
|
|
* must be in the PEM format.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* NOTE: This is unsupported on iOS.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* @param cert: Certificate contents in memory.
|
||
|
|
* @param pkey: Private key contents in memory.
|
||
|
|
* @param allocator Memory allocator to use.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
static TlsContextOptions InitClientWithMtls(
|
||
|
|
const ByteCursor &cert,
|
||
|
|
const ByteCursor &pkey,
|
||
|
|
Allocator *allocator = ApiAllocator())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* Initializes TlsContextOptions for mutual TLS (mTLS),
|
||
|
|
* using a PKCS#11 library for private key operations.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* NOTE: This only works on Unix devices.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* @param pkcs11Options PKCS#11 options
|
||
|
|
* @param allocator Memory allocator to use.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
static TlsContextOptions InitClientWithMtlsPkcs11(
|
||
|
|
const TlsContextPkcs11Options &pkcs11Options,
|
||
|
|
Allocator *allocator = ApiAllocator())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* Initializes TlsContextOptions for mutual TLS (mTLS), with
|
||
|
|
* client certificate and private key in the PKCS#12 format.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* NOTE: This only works on Apple devices.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* @param pkcs12_path: Path to PKCS #12 file. The file is loaded from disk and stored internally. It
|
||
|
|
* must remain in memory for the lifetime of the returned object.
|
||
|
|
* @param pkcs12_pwd: Password to PKCS #12 file. It must remain in memory for the lifetime of the
|
||
|
|
* returned object.
|
||
|
|
* @param allocator Memory allocator to use.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
static TlsContextOptions InitClientWithMtlsPkcs12(
|
||
|
|
const char *pkcs12_path,
|
||
|
|
const char *pkcs12_pwd,
|
||
|
|
Allocator *allocator = ApiAllocator())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* @deprecated Custom keychain management is deprecated.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* By default the certificates and private keys are stored in the default keychain
|
||
|
|
* of the account of the process. If you instead wish to provide your own keychain
|
||
|
|
* for storing them, this makes the TlsContext to use that instead.
|
||
|
|
* NOTE: The password of your keychain must be empty.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* NOTE: This only works on MacOS.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
bool SetKeychainPath(ByteCursor &keychain_path)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* Initializes TlsContextOptions for mutual TLS (mTLS),
|
||
|
|
* using a client certificate in a Windows certificate store.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* NOTE: This only works on Windows.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* @param windowsCertStorePath Path to certificate in a Windows certificate store.
|
||
|
|
* The path must use backslashes and end with the certificate's thumbprint.
|
||
|
|
* Example: `CurrentUser\MY\A11F8A9B5DF5B98BA3508FBCA575D09570E0D2C6`
|
||
|
|
* @param allocator The memory allocator to use.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
static TlsContextOptions InitClientWithMtlsSystemPath(
|
||
|
|
const char *windowsCertStorePath,
|
||
|
|
Allocator *allocator = ApiAllocator())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* @return true if alpn is supported by the underlying security provider, false
|
||
|
|
* otherwise.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
static bool IsAlpnSupported() no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* Sets the list of alpn protocols.
|
||
|
|
* @param alpnList: List of protocol names, delimited by ';'. This string must remain in memory for the
|
||
|
|
* lifetime of this object.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
bool SetAlpnList(const char *alpnList)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* In client mode, this turns off x.509 validation. Don't do this unless you're testing.
|
||
|
|
* It's much better, to just override the default trust store and pass the self-signed
|
||
|
|
* certificate as the caFile argument.
|
||
|
|
*
|
||
|
|
* In server mode, this defaults to false. If you want to support mutual TLS from the server,
|
||
|
|
* you'll want to set this to true.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
void SetVerifyPeer(bool verifyPeer)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* Sets the minimum TLS version allowed.
|
||
|
|
* @param minimumTlsVersion: The minimum TLS version.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
void SetMinimumTlsVersion(aws_tls_versions minimumTlsVersion);
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* Sets the preferred TLS Cipher List
|
||
|
|
* @param cipher_pref: The preferred TLS cipher list.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
void SetTlsCipherPreference(aws_tls_cipher_pref cipher_pref);
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* Overrides the default system trust store.
|
||
|
|
* @param caPath: Path to directory containing trusted certificates, which will overrides the
|
||
|
|
* default trust store. Only useful on Unix style systems where all anchors are stored in a directory
|
||
|
|
* (like /etc/ssl/certs). This string must remain in memory for the lifetime of this object.
|
||
|
|
* @param caFile: Path to file containing PEM armored chain of trusted CA certificates. This
|
||
|
|
* string must remain in memory for the lifetime of this object.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
bool OverrideDefaultTrustStore(const char *caPath, const char *caFile)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/**
|
||
|
|
* Overrides the default system trust store.
|
||
|
|
* @param ca: PEM armored chain of trusted CA certificates.
|
||
|
|
*/
|
||
|
|
bool OverrideDefaultTrustStore(const ByteCursor &ca) noexcept;
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
/// @private
|
||
|
|
const aws_tls_ctx_options *GetUnderlyingHandle() const noexcept { return &m_options; }
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
private:
|
||
|
|
aws_tls_ctx_options m_options;
|
||
|
|
bool m_isInit;
|
||
|
|
};
